2013 was Kate Moss’s most lucrative year of her career so far. The 40 year old supermodel’s, (yes, 40) business assets rose from £11 million, to almost £17 million. This is on top of her personal fortune which stands at £55 million. There was once an age limit for models, but Moss is living proof that this can be altered, and her power remains undiminished. In fact, she’s only just getting started.
No wonder 2013 was her best year to date. Moss was kept pretty busy. She starred in various campaigns such as Rag & Bone, St. Topez, Matchless and Stuart Weitzman, she collaborated with Carphone Warehouse and continued her contract with Rimmel. On top of all that, she also released a book and appeared on the cover of Playboy’s 60th anniversary issue.
